Government Funded Public Services
For those who don’t know where to start, CEDIA recommends that you first see if there are publicly funded services in your area. Most countries provide some type of government funded services to jobseekers. While services vary from country to country, the following are the most common services provided:
- Career counseling and exploration
- Employability/Soft skills training
- Job search assistance
- Resume/CV development
- Interview preparation
- Networking events and job fairs
- Financial assistance for short-term training that leads to credential attainment
- Unemployment benefits
Services are typically provided virtually and in-person at local offices:
- United States: American Job Centers
- United Kingdom: JobCentre Plus
- Canada: Employment and Social Development Canada
- Australia: Jobactive
- Mexico: Servicio Nacional de Empleo
- India: National Career Service
Integration Industry Services and Platforms
In addition to publicly funded career development services, there are several companies within the integration industry that provide jobseekers with free career development services and platforms. The following as just a few that CEDIA recommends that jobseekers learn more about:
- AV Hero is a technology platform that connects customers to a network of certified audiovisual technicians.
- AV Junction connects integrators with freelance AV Technicians.
- HD Staffing is a staffing company with a focus on custom electronic integration and construction staffing experience.
- HireSparks is the premier Executive Search Firm dedicated to the Audio-Visual Integration & Manufacturing Industries.
- Integrator Jobs is a job posting and search service from industry-leading publications and websites — CE Pro, Commercial Integrator, and Security Sales & Integration.
- Lincedge is a platform that allows integrators to share labor resources.
- The Park West Group is an executive search firm that place sales, marketing and technical executives for manufacturers, rep firms and distributors from support to national leadership roles.
- TierPM is a certified diverse audio visual and IT workforce solutions company offering recruiting, staffing, application development and project management solutions for clients nationwide.
- Verigent is a staffing agency that connects low voltage technicians to the Telecom and IT industries.
